About this clinic

Resilience Code operates a multi-disciplinary facility in Englewood on Inverness Drive East, combining mental health services with physical therapy, fitness programming, and medical laboratory capabilities under one roof. The integrated model addresses both psychiatric and physical health needs for adults seeking coordinated care. Specific mental health treatment modalities—including whether TMS, ketamine, or esketamine are offered—are not detailed in available listings. The practice accepts appointments through its website and phone line for initial consultations.
